Quick summary
Large, autonomous “AI agents” — systems that can plan, act, and complete multi-step tasks with little human prompting — are moving from demos into real business use. Over the last year, major vendors added agent frameworks and enterprises started deploying them for sales outreach, automated reporting, customer follow-up, and routine process work. At the same time, regulations and governance conversations have pushed companies to add safety, auditing, and human-in-the-loop controls.

Why this matters for business leaders

  • Faster outcomes: Agents can assemble data, draft emails, generate reports, and trigger follow-up actions without manual handoffs — reducing time-to-action from days to hours.
  • Better scaling: Routine tasks (e.g., weekly sales reports, lead qualification, invoice checks) scale without hiring proportional headcount.
  • Risk and trust require planning: Agents can make mistakes or use data in ways you didn’t expect. Firms that skip governance face legal, brand, and compliance risks.
  • Competitive edge: Early adopters who combine agents with clean data and clear KPIs are already improving win rates, shortening sales cycles, and cutting operational costs.

Practical ways your business can use this trend

  • Sales outreach: Use agents to qualify leads, draft personalized outreach based on CRM and recent customer signals, and create follow-up tasks for reps.
  • Reporting automation: Let agents collect data from multiple systems, generate narrative summaries for weekly/monthly reports, and flag anomalies for review.
  • Internal automation: Automate routine approvals, vendor checks, and HR onboarding steps so your teams focus on exceptions and strategy.
  • Customer support triage: Agents can resolve simple tickets and escalate complex cases with a full case summary attached.

Quick checklist to get started

  • Pick one clear process that’s manual and repeatable.
  • Confirm the data sources and access controls you’ll need.
  • Design a simple approval loop for the agent’s first 30–90 days.
  • Track baseline metrics before you launch the pilot.
